Passive RFID technology has been widely applied, but mainly for an automatic identification of objects like in logistics applications. In this paper, as a novel approach the passive RFID system is applied to stream data transmission, where the RFID reader sends stream data and tags receive them. An ultra-low-power baseband controller in wireless endoscopic capsule is designed in asynchronous circuits based on the 2-wire protocols. The controller is adaptive to different data rates defined by an external reference data rate clock source. In many DSP applications (image and voice processing, baseband symbol decoding in high quality communication channels) several dBs of SNR loss can be tolerated without noticeable impact on system level performance.
